This tour offers a unique experience of Quito, blending rich history, impressive architecture, and panoramic views. Visit the Basilica of the National Vow for a 360° view of the city and nearby volcanoes, explore Plaza Grande’s historic monuments, and admire the gold-leaf decorated Compañía de Jesús church. You’ll also visit Plaza de San Francisco, see the Virgin of Quito sculpture, and enjoy Ecuadorian chocolate in Yumbos. At Loma del Panecillo, take in the view with the largest statue in Ecuador, and finish with a visit to the Intiñan Museum at the Middle of the World. A perfect mix of history, culture, and local flavors in one day.

Itinerary

Duration: 9 to 16 hours (approximately)
  • 1
    Basilica del Voto Nacional

    Pick up from your hotel and transfer to the Basilica of the National Vow. Here you can admire a neo-Gothic building and ascend its towers to enjoy a 360° panoramic view of Quito, highlighting the modern and old cities, the Pichincha Volcano, and, weather permitting, the Cotopaxi, Antisana, and Cayambe volcanoes.

    1 hour Admission ticket free
  • 2
    Fundacion Iglesia de la Compania

    A walking tour of Plaza Grande, where you can admire important buildings such as the Government Palace, the Independence Monument, the façade of Quito's Primate Cathedral, and the "El Sagrario" church, among others. We will also visit the "Compañía de Jesús" church, known for its gold-leafed interior.

    20 minutes Admission ticket free
  • 3
    Iglesia y Convento de San Francisco

    Visit the Plaza and Church of San Francisco, with a tour of the church's interior to see the sculpture of the Virgin of Quito, created by Bernardo de Legarda, and the impressive Baroque decoration. Visit a chocolate shop in the area, called Yumbos, where you can taste different flavors and intensities of cocoa.

    2 hours Admission ticket included
  • 4

    Ascent to Loma del Panecillo, home to the Virgin of Quito, the largest religious statue in Ecuador, with a spectacular view of Quito's old town and the Pichincha Volcano.

    40 minutes Admission ticket included
  • 5
    Mitad Del Mundo

    Visit the Middle of the World, where we will explore the Intiñan Museum, located at latitude 0°0'0", and learn about the history of the equator, with demonstrations on the Coriolis effect and the culture of the Andean and Amazonian regions.

    1 hour Admission ticket included
  • 6
    Quito

    Return to the hotel to conclude the tour. Dinner and overnight stay not included.
